How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Southwest Bellevue?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Southwest Bellevue Studio Apartments | $2,153 | $1,680 | $4,556 |
Southwest Bellevue 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,801 | $1,710 | $7,505 |
Southwest Bellevue 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,084 | $2,648 | $9,685 |
Southwest Bellevue 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,203 | $2,900 | $10,000+ |

Getting Around the Southwest Bellevue Neighborhood in Bellevue, WA
Walk Score®
64 / 100
Somewhat Walkable
Some err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
47 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
46 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
